AbstractFilm copies of original astronomical plates taken with the 1.2-metre UK Schmidt Telescope (UKST) at Siding Spring Observatory, New South Wales have been used for several years at Edinburgh University. Two teaching packages are intended for undergraduate use; the educational packages are mainly designed as visual aids for colleges, schools and amateur groups.

The UK 1.2m Schmidt Telescope (an outstation of the Royal Observatory Edinburgh) is situated at Siding Spring Observatory in New South Wales, Australia. The telescope has been operational since 1973 and has, to date, taken about 7000 plates. This paper discusses some of the problems associated with cataloguing these plates and keeping track of their locations.
